subgiant

noun

Etymology

From sub- + giant.

  1. derived from γίγας
  2. derived from gigās
  3. derived from *gagās
  4. derived from geant
  5. inherited from geaunt
  6. prefixed as subgiant — “sub + giant

Definitions

  1. A star that has left the main sequence but has not yet become a true giant star.
